Lisovská skála is a distinctive natural monument and a prominent peak, rising to an elevation of 802 meters above sea level, nestled within the picturesque Žďárské vrchy (Žďár Hills) in the Vysočina Region of the Czech Republic. This unique geological formation, primarily composed of gneiss rock, is celebrated for its exceptional examples of frost weathering, making it a significant landmark for nature enthusiasts and geologists alike.     Lisovská skála is accessible by following the red tourist sign on the way from Velké Dářek via Žákova hora to Sněžné. Climbing activities and maintenance of existing climbing routes are permitted on Lisovská skála from July 1 to December 31 of a given year. The reason for this is that this rock, like other rock formations in the vicinity, can serve as a nesting ground for protected bird species, which include the great raven, wood hawk, great horned owl, speckled nuthatch, ruffed grouse, lesser plover and other species.[3]

    Lisovská skála is an 802 meter high peak in the Žďárské vrchy mountain range. It is located three kilometers southwest of the settlement of Křižánky in the district of Žďár nad Sázavou and one kilometer southeast of Devíti skal. The peak is made of gneiss rock, which is a natural monument. The peak is wooded, without a view. Rather than a separate peak, it is the western sub-peak of Křovina (830 m above sea level), 1.2 km away.

    What are the unique geological features to look out for at Lisovská skála?

    Lisovská skála is renowned for its exceptional examples of frost weathering of gneiss rock. Key features include two connected rock ridges up to 12 meters high, a rare cryoplanation terrace at its base, and an expansive boulder field (or 'stone sea') measuring approximately 80 x 50 meters. You can also observe distinct layered formations and 'rock mushroom' shapes formed by erosion.

    Can I climb the rocks at Lisovská skála, and are there any restrictions?

    Yes, climbing activities on the rocks at Lisovská skála are permitted, but with strict seasonal restrictions. Climbing is only allowed from July 1st to December 31st each year. This is to protect nesting bird species, such as ravens and goshawks, during their breeding season. Maintenance of existing climbing routes is also subject to this timeframe.

    What kind of wildlife can be observed around Lisovská skála?

    The forest surrounding Lisovská skála is a haven for various woodland bird species. Hikers and birdwatchers might spot black woodpeckers, great spotted woodpeckers, long-eared owls, spotted nutcrackers, and crested tits. Buzzards, goshawks, and ravens are also present in the area, particularly during non-breeding seasons.

    How does Lisovská skála compare to other natural monuments in the Žďárské vrchy region?

    Lisovská skála stands out for its exceptional display of frost weathering on gneiss rock, including its unique cryoplanation terrace and extensive boulder field. While other monuments like Devět skal (Nine Rocks) are known for their prominent rock formations and climbing opportunities, Lisovská skála offers a more focused geological study of ancient freeze-thaw cycles and a quieter, wooded summit experience.
